Abstract: The relationship between particle shape and fineness of fine aggregate and the pressure transferabuility of fresh mortar was experimentally obtained. Four types of fine aggregate with variety of fineness and shape were used for this research. It was confirmed that finer or shperical shape of fine aggregate particle can increase the pressure transferability. Solid volume was employed as the the index of the particle shape. Fineness Modulus was employed as the index for the fineness of the fine aggregate. A method by using the relationship between FM and solid volume of fine aggregate particles to obtain the same pressure transferability was proposed.
